Web19 jul. 2024 · Goals or objectives. You can include the project goals and objectives of the client in the executive summary, in the project summary, or in a section dedicated just for this purpose.. You might write 75 - 150 words describing the goals, or utilize a bulleted list of 3-8 goals. Approach. Our second example comes from a sample proposal submitted by Yerba Buena Center for the Arts to the Museums … WebWhen creating a proposal, it's important to include critical information at the beginning to provide a clear overview of the project. Your first few pages should include the company name, project title, executive summary, project timeframe, who prepared it, what documents are attached, contact information, and a table of contents. Web7 mrt. 2024 · Project proposals are documents designed to present a plan of action, outline the reasons why the action is necessary, and convince the reader to agree with and approve the implementation of the actions recommended in the body of the document. In many cases, the document is drafted as a response to a Request for Proposal (RFP) that is …
